| | |
| | | private UmsRoleResourceRelationService roleResourceRelationService; |
| | | |
| | | private UmsMenuService umsMenuService; |
| | | |
| | | @Autowired |
| | | public void setUmsMenuService(UmsMenuService umsMenuService) { |
| | | this.umsMenuService = umsMenuService; |
| | |
| | | private UmsResourceMapper umsResourceMapper; |
| | | @Resource |
| | | private DataDictionaryMapper dataDictionaryMapper; |
| | | |
| | | @Override |
| | | public boolean create(UmsRole role) { |
| | | role.setCreateTime(new Date()); |
| | |
| | | Page<UmsRole> resultPage = page(page, wrapper); |
| | | List<UmsRole> roles = resultPage.getRecords(); |
| | | List<Long> types = roles.stream().map(UmsRole::getType).collect(Collectors.toList()); |
| | | |
| | | if (types.size() > 0) { |
| | | LambdaQueryWrapper<DataDictionary> dicQuery = new LambdaQueryWrapper<>(); |
| | | dicQuery.in(DataDictionary::getId, types); |
| | | List<DataDictionary> dics = dataDictionaryMapper.selectList(dicQuery); |
| | |
| | | } |
| | | } |
| | | } |
| | | } |
| | | return resultPage; |
| | | } |
| | | |